// Package cli: acl.go implements the `orca acl` subcommand family
// (P02, v0.11). Subcommands:
//
// orca acl grant <identity> --namespace <ns> --permissions <perms>
// orca acl revoke <identity> --namespace <ns>
// orca acl list
// orca acl check <identity> --namespace <ns> --permission <perm>
//
// ACL state is stored at paths.ClusterDir()/acl.json (a simple JSON
// file — no DB needed for v0.11). <identity> is either a SPIFFE URI
// (spiffe://orca.local/ns/.../sa/.../...) or a bare token ID.
package cli
import (
"encoding/json"
"fmt"
"log/slog"
"os"
"path/filepath"
"strings"
"github.com/spf13/cobra"
"git.cloudinit.dev/coreci/orca/internal/acl"
"git.cloudinit.dev/coreci/orca/internal/paths"
"git.cloudinit.dev/coreci/orca/internal/security"
)
var (
aclGrantNamespace string
aclGrantPermissions string
aclRevokeNamespace string
aclCheckNamespace string
aclCheckPermission string
aclCheckVerbose bool
)
var aclCmd = &cobra.Command{
Use: "acl",
Short: "Manage access-control entries (SPIFFE + token identities)",
Long: `Manage the cluster ACL (P02, v0.11). Identities are either
SPIFFE workload URIs (spiffe://orca.local/ns/<ns>/sa/<sa>/<alloc>) or
operator token IDs. Permissions are deny-by-default: an identity with
no matching entry on a namespace has no access.
State is stored at ` + "`" + `ClusterDir()/acl.json` + "`" + `.`,
}
// parseIdentity classifies <identity> as a SPIFFE or token identity.
// A SPIFFE identity is detected by the spiffe:// scheme; its namespace
// is extracted from the URI path. Anything else is treated as a token
// ID whose namespace must be supplied via the --namespace flag.
func parseIdentity(raw string) (acl.Identity, error) {
if strings.HasPrefix(raw, "spiffe://") {
ns, err := acl.SpiffeNamespace(raw)
if err != nil {
return acl.Identity{}, fmt.Errorf("parse spiffe identity: %w", err)
}
return acl.Identity{Kind: acl.KindSpiffe, ID: raw, Namespace: ns}, nil
}
if raw == "" {
return acl.Identity{}, fmt.Errorf("identity is empty")
}
return acl.Identity{Kind: acl.KindOidc, ID: raw}, nil
}
// parsePermissions parses a comma-separated list of "read","write",
// "admin" into a Permission bitmask. Empty string defaults to read.
func parsePermissions(s string) (acl.Permission, error) {
s = strings.TrimSpace(s)
if s == "" {
return acl.PermRead, nil
}
var perms acl.Permission
for _, part := range strings.Split(s, ",") {
part = strings.TrimSpace(strings.ToLower(part))
switch part {
case "read":
perms |= acl.PermRead
case "write":
perms |= acl.PermWrite
case "admin":
perms |= acl.PermAdmin
default:
return 0, fmt.Errorf("unknown permission %q (want read, write, or admin)", part)
}
}
if perms == 0 {
return 0, fmt.Errorf("no permissions in %q", s)
}
return perms, nil
}
// permName renders a Permission bitmask as a comma-separated string.
func permName(p acl.Permission) string {
var parts []string
if p&acl.PermRead != 0 {
parts = append(parts, "read")
}
if p&acl.PermWrite != 0 {
parts = append(parts, "write")
}
if p&acl.PermAdmin != 0 {
parts = append(parts, "admin")
}
if len(parts) == 0 {
return "none"
}
return strings.Join(parts, ",")
}
// aclState is the on-disk JSON shape for acl.json.
type aclState struct {
Entries []acl.ACLEntry `json:"entries"`
}
// loadACL reads paths.ACLPath() and returns an *acl.ACL. A missing
// file is treated as an empty ACL (not an error).
func loadACL() (*acl.ACL, error) {
a := acl.NewACL()
path := paths.ACLPath()
data, err := os.ReadFile(path)
if err != nil {
if os.IsNotExist(err) {
return a, nil
}
return nil, fmt.Errorf("read acl state: %w", err)
}
if len(data) == 0 {
return a, nil
}
var st aclState
if err := json.Unmarshal(data, &st); err != nil {
return nil, fmt.Errorf("parse acl state: %w", err)
}
for _, e := range st.Entries {
a.Grant(e.Identity, e.Namespace, e.Permissions)
}
return a, nil
}
// saveACL writes the ACL to paths.ACLPath() atomically (write to temp,
// rename). The cluster dir is created if missing.
func saveACL(a *acl.ACL) error {
path := paths.ACLPath()
if err := os.MkdirAll(filepath.Dir(path), 0o755); err != nil {
return fmt.Errorf("create cluster dir: %w", err)
}
st := aclState{Entries: a.List()}
data, err := json.MarshalIndent(st, "", " ")
if err != nil {
return fmt.Errorf("marshal acl state: %w", err)
}
// P04 (T6): acl.json contains the access-control policy and
// must be 0600 (operator-only). Previously 0644 — world-readable
// leaked the SPIFFE IDs and OIDC subs of privileged identities.
if err := writeAtomicFile(path, data, 0o600); err != nil {
return fmt.Errorf("write acl state: %w", err)
}
return nil
}
// lockACL acquires an exclusive advisory lock on the acl.json file
// (P04, T7). The lock file is paths.ACLPath() + ".lock". Returns a
// release function that MUST be deferred. Used by grant/revoke to
// prevent concurrent read-modify-write races (two operators running
// `orca acl grant` simultaneously would otherwise clobber each
// other's entries).
func lockACL() (func(), error) {
// Ensure the cluster dir exists before flock tries to create the
// lock file (security.Flock opens with O_CREATE but requires the
// parent dir to exist).
if err := os.MkdirAll(filepath.Dir(paths.ACLPath()), 0o755); err != nil {
return nil, fmt.Errorf("create cluster dir: %w", err)
}
return security.Flock(paths.ACLPath() + ".lock")
}
// writeAtomicFile writes data atomically (REQ-156, P07 T9).
// Previously a local copy of the temp+chmod+rename pattern (P02 kept a
// local copy to avoid importing internal/security); it lacked fsync,
// so a crash between write and rename could promote a partially-durable
// file. Now a thin wrapper around the canonical security.WriteAtomic
// (temp + chmod + fsync + rename) so all CLI atomic writes share one
// fsync-correct implementation.
func writeAtomicFile(path string, data []byte, mode os.FileMode) error {
return security.WriteAtomic(path, mode, data)
}
var aclGrantCmd = &cobra.Command{
Use: "grant <identity>",
Short: "Grant permissions to an identity on a namespace",
Long: `Grant permissions to an identity on a namespace. The identity
is either a SPIFFE URI (its namespace is extracted from the path and
must match --namespace) or a bare token ID (whose namespace is
--namespace). --permissions is a comma-separated list of read,write,
admin (default: read).`,
Args: cobra.ExactArgs(1),
RunE: func(cmd *cobra.Command, args []string) error {
identity, err := parseIdentity(args[0])
if err != nil {
return err
}
ns := aclGrantNamespace
if ns == "" {
ns = identity.Namespace
}
if ns == "" {
return fmt.Errorf("--namespace is required for token identities (or set it to match the spiffe path)")
}
if identity.Kind == acl.KindSpiffe && identity.Namespace != "" && identity.Namespace != ns {
return fmt.Errorf("spiffe namespace %q does not match --namespace %q", identity.Namespace, ns)
}
perms, err := parsePermissions(aclGrantPermissions)
if err != nil {
return err
}
// P04 (T7): flock around the read-modify-write so two
// concurrent `orca acl grant` invocations don't clobber each
// other's entries.
release, err := lockACL()
if err != nil {
return fmt.Errorf("acquire acl lock: %w", err)
}
defer release()
a, err := loadACL()
if err != nil {
return err
}
identity.Namespace = ns
a.Grant(identity, ns, perms)
if err := saveACL(a); err != nil {
return err
}
slog.Info("acl grant", "identity", identity.ID, "namespace", ns, "permissions", permName(perms))
if jsonOutput {
return printJSON(map[string]any{
"identity": identity,
"namespace": ns,
"permissions": permName(perms),
"granted": true,
})
}
fmt.Fprintf(cmd.OutOrStdout(), "✓ Granted %s on %s to %s\n", permName(perms), ns, identity.ID)
return nil
},
}
var aclRevokeCmd = &cobra.Command{
Use: "revoke <identity>",
Short: "Revoke an identity's access on a namespace",
Long: `Revoke an identity's entry on a namespace. For a SPIFFE
identity the namespace defaults to the one in the URI path; for a
token identity --namespace is required.`,
Args: cobra.ExactArgs(1),
RunE: func(cmd *cobra.Command, args []string) error {
identity, err := parseIdentity(args[0])
if err != nil {
return err
}
ns := aclRevokeNamespace
if ns == "" {
ns = identity.Namespace
}
if ns == "" {
return fmt.Errorf("--namespace is required for token identities")
}
// P04 (T7): flock around the read-modify-write.
release, err := lockACL()
if err != nil {
return fmt.Errorf("acquire acl lock: %w", err)
}
defer release()
a, err := loadACL()
if err != nil {
return err
}
identity.Namespace = ns
a.Revoke(identity, ns)
if err := saveACL(a); err != nil {
return err
}
slog.Info("acl revoke", "identity", identity.ID, "namespace", ns)
if jsonOutput {
return printJSON(map[string]any{
"identity": identity,
"namespace": ns,
"revoked": true,
})
}
fmt.Fprintf(cmd.OutOrStdout(), "✓ Revoked %s on %s\n", identity.ID, ns)
return nil
},
}
var aclListCmd = &cobra.Command{
Use: "list",
Short: "List all ACL entries",
Args: cobra.NoArgs,
RunE: func(cmd *cobra.Command, args []string) error {
a, err := loadACL()
if err != nil {
return err
}
entries := a.List()
if jsonOutput {
return printJSON(entries)
}
out := cmd.OutOrStdout()
if len(entries) == 0 {
fmt.Fprintln(out, "No ACL entries. Use `orca acl grant` to add one.")
return nil
}
fmt.Fprintf(out, "%-12s %-50s %-16s %s\n", "KIND", "IDENTITY", "NAMESPACE", "PERMISSIONS")
for _, e := range entries {
fmt.Fprintf(out, "%-12s %-50s %-16s %s\n", e.Identity.Kind, e.Identity.ID, e.Namespace, permName(e.Permissions))
}
return nil
},
}
var aclCheckCmd = &cobra.Command{
Use: "check <identity>",
Short: "Check whether an identity has a permission on a namespace",
Long: `Check whether an identity has the given permission on the
namespace. Exits 0 if allowed, 1 if denied. --permission is one of
read, write, admin (default: read).`,
Args: cobra.ExactArgs(1),
RunE: func(cmd *cobra.Command, args []string) error {
identity, err := parseIdentity(args[0])
if err != nil {
return err
}
ns := aclCheckNamespace
if ns == "" {
ns = identity.Namespace
}
if ns == "" {
return fmt.Errorf("--namespace is required for token identities")
}
permStr := strings.TrimSpace(aclCheckPermission)
if permStr == "" {
permStr = "read"
}
perm, err := parsePermissions(permStr)
if err != nil {
return err
}
a, err := loadACL()
if err != nil {
return err
}
identity.Namespace = ns
allowed := a.Check(identity, ns, perm)
if aclCheckVerbose {
fmt.Fprintf(cmd.ErrOrStderr(), "ACL path: %s\n", paths.ACLPath())
fmt.Fprintf(cmd.ErrOrStderr(), "Identity: kind=%s id=%s ns=%s\n", identity.Kind, identity.ID, ns)
fmt.Fprintf(cmd.ErrOrStderr(), "Permission: %s -> allowed=%v\n", permStr, allowed)
entries := a.List()
fmt.Fprintf(cmd.ErrOrStderr(), "ACL entries (%d):\n", len(entries))
for _, e := range entries {
fmt.Fprintf(cmd.ErrOrStderr(), " kind=%s id=%s ns=%s perms=%d\n", e.Identity.Kind, e.Identity.ID, e.Namespace, e.Permissions)
}
}
if jsonOutput {
return printJSON(map[string]any{
"identity": identity,
"namespace": ns,
"permission": permStr,
"allowed": allowed,
})
}
if allowed {
fmt.Fprintf(cmd.OutOrStdout(), "✓ %s has %s on %s\n", identity.ID, permStr, ns)
return nil
}
fmt.Fprintf(cmd.OutOrStdout(), "✗ %s does NOT have %s on %s\n", identity.ID, permStr, ns)
return fmt.Errorf("denied")
},
}
func init() {
aclGrantCmd.Flags().StringVar(&aclGrantNamespace, "namespace", "", "namespace scope (required for tokens; defaults to spiffe path ns)")
aclGrantCmd.Flags().StringVar(&aclGrantPermissions, "permissions", "read", "comma-separated permissions: read,write,admin")
aclRevokeCmd.Flags().StringVar(&aclRevokeNamespace, "namespace", "", "namespace scope (required for tokens; defaults to spiffe path ns)")
aclCheckCmd.Flags().StringVar(&aclCheckNamespace, "namespace", "", "namespace scope (required for tokens; defaults to spiffe path ns)")
aclCheckCmd.Flags().BoolVar(&aclCheckVerbose, "verbose", false, "print ACL path + loaded entries for debugging")
aclCheckCmd.Flags().StringVar(&aclCheckPermission, "permission", "read", "permission to check: read, write, or admin")
aclCmd.AddCommand(aclGrantCmd)
aclCmd.AddCommand(aclRevokeCmd)
aclCmd.AddCommand(aclListCmd)
aclCmd.AddCommand(aclCheckCmd)
rootCmd.AddCommand(aclCmd)
}
